MazzikaAI: Real-Time Arabic Maqam Accompaniment via Streaming Text-to-Music
MazzikaAI has been developed by researchers as a knowledge-driven system to offer real-time accompaniment for Arabic maqam music, which is noted for its microtonal intervals, modal frameworks, and intricate call-and-response techniques. This innovation fills a crucial void in generative music models, which mainly focus on Western equal-tempered systems, leaving Arabic maqam underrepresented. By utilizing natural language as a control mechanism, MazzikaAI integrates live MIDI, gestures, and inferred harmony into constantly refreshed text prompts. It operates an unmodified streaming generator, Google Lyria RealTime, without the need for model adjustments. The system incorporates expertise on six fundamental maqamat and relevant ornaments, ensuring subsecond key-to-audio latency. This research, available on arXiv (2608.10360), underscores the promise of text-to-music models with specific control interfaces tailored for distinct musical traditions.
